Wan 3.0 Text-to-Video API

Wan 3.0 is Alibaba's Tongyi Lab's next-generation video generation model officially released on August 24, 2026. This document covers its Text-to-Video endpoint: generating high-quality video from text prompts alone, with native 30-second single-pass generation, 480P/720P/1080P resolution tiers, native synchronized audio and multilingual dubbing, and 30 FPS output. The model significantly improves micro-expressions, body linkage, spatial layout, physical motion, and text rendering to reduce the "AI feel" and approach real-shot quality.

On iCreat, developers call the aliyun/wan3-0/text-to-video endpoint through an asynchronous task-based REST API. Pricing: 480P $0.05/sec, 720P $0.10/sec, 1080P $0.20/sec, billed by output duration.

Model Positioning

Wan 3.0 Text-to-Video targets text-driven video creation — the T2V endpoint of the Wan 3.0 unified model. Compared to its predecessor Wan 2.7 (15-second max), single-pass duration doubles to 30 seconds, suited for short dramas, ads, and music videos requiring continuous narrative. Supports an optional thinking mode (reasoning before generation) for multi-event sequences and complex compositions. Wan 3.0 is a closed-source API model with no weight downloads, unlike the open-source Wan 2.2 series.

Core Capabilities

30-second single-pass generation

A single request can generate up to 30 seconds of continuous video — double Wan 2.7's 15-second limit. Supports intelligent duration recommendations and an extend function for continuous narrative.

Three resolution tiers

Supports 480P, 720P, and 1080P, defaulting to 1080P. 480P for low-cost draft iteration, 1080P for final delivery.

Native synchronized audio

Audio is generated in the same pass as the video (not added in post), including dialogue, BGM, and sound effects, ensuring temporal alignment between sound and motion. Supports multilingual dubbing.

Real-world fidelity

Significant improvements in micro-expressions, body linkage, spatial layout, physical motion, and on-screen text rendering, reducing the "AI feel" for a real-shot look.

Thinking mode

Optional reasoning mode — the model reasons about composition and motion before generating, suited for multi-event sequences and complex compositions.

Negative prompts

Supports negative_prompt to describe content that should not appear in the video, improving generation control.

Specifications

Category Description
Model name Wan 3.0 Text-to-Video
Developer Alibaba (Tongyi Lab)
Endpoint aliyun/wan3-0/text-to-video
Release date August 24, 2026 (public beta August 6)
Model type Video generation model (closed-source API)
Authentication API Key (Authorization: Bearer)
input.prompt string, required, describes the video content to generate
input.negative_prompt string, optional, content that should not appear in the video
parameters.resolution string, required; 480P, 720P, 1080P
parameters.ratio string, required; 1:1, 9:16, 16:9, 3:4, 4:3
parameters.duration integer, required; 4–30 seconds
parameters.watermark boolean, optional; default false
Output Video file; 30 FPS, native synchronized audio, up to 30 seconds
Frame rate 30 FPS
Billing unit USD per second
API mode Asynchronous task submission

Architecture

Wan 3.0 uses a unified model architecture, consolidating text-to-video, image-to-video, and reference-to-video into a single endpoint rather than separate models. The model introduces an "Omni-Reference" system supporting up to ~20 reference assets (text, images, video, audio, documents, web pages) for high-fidelity video synthesis. Audio is generated in the same pass as the video, ensuring temporal alignment.

Wan 3.0 entered public beta on August 6, 2026, and launched commercially on August 24. Unlike the open-source Wan 2.2 series, Wan 3.0 is a closed-source API model with no weight downloads. Available on Alibaba Cloud Bailian (Beijing, Singapore regions) and Qianwen AI platform, with a limited 30% discount (August 24 to September 23).

Notes

  • duration must be an integer between 4 and 30; out-of-range values return an error
  • prompt is required; negative_prompt is optional, used to exclude unwanted content
  • 480P tier for low-cost draft iteration ($0.05/sec), 1080P for final delivery ($0.20/sec)
  • 1080P costs more per second than 720P; estimate cost in advance for long videos (total = unit price × duration)
  • Native audio is default output, including dialogue, BGM, and sound effects, synchronized with visuals
  • Thinking mode is optional, suited for multi-event sequences and complex compositions
  • Fetch results via the result endpoint promptly after completion
  • Wan 3.0 is a closed-source API model, not supporting local deployment; for self-hosting, use the open-source Wan 2.2 series
